    Recently a friend of mine decided to travel Europe for a few months and then she was moving back to New Zealand. She is newly pregnant, so I wanted to make her a going away gift. I pulled out my Dr. Seuss fabrics since it's not gender specific.

    [img]http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3518/...8d41f0b4_z.jpg[/img]

    I made this quilt in about 5 hours start to finish. It is about 38x50, which I purposely did so I wouldn't have to piece the back. :) I used a blue polka dot on the back:

    [img]http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3630/...93a05006_z.jpg[/img]

    The quilting is a meander style that was done on my Longarm machine (Handiquilter 16):

    [img]http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3491/...5726f332_z.jpg[/img]

    [img]http://farm3.static.flickr.com/2001/...7c86bb3e_z.jpg[/img]

    The binding is in the same grey that is on the quilt itself. She really loved the quilt!! I hope she is able to put it to good use once the baby comes. Thanks for looking!! :)
